Written Answers. - Galway County Council Staff.

29.

asked the Minister for the Environment (a) the number of engineers employed by Galway County Council in (i) 1984 and (ii) 1985; and (b) the number of clerical staff employed in (i) 1984 and (ii) 1985.

The information sought in respect of the year ended 31 December 1984 the latest date for which such information is available, is set out hereunder. The information has been compiled from returns furnished to my Department by Galway County Council.

The numbers shown include staff employed both in a permanent and temporary capacity, and the term clerical staff is taken to relate to clerical-administrative staff (Grade I to VII): (i) number employed in engineering posts at 31/12/84 — 49; (ii) number of clerical staff employed at 31/12/84 — 140.
